To evaluate and compare the validity and reliability of individual and composite recall pain intensity measures. Secondary analyses using data from a published 14-day open-label crossover clinical trial comparing two active treatments. Multiple settings. Fifty-two adults with a history of chronic cancer pain. Recall ratings of least, worst, and average pain during the past 2 days; composite score representing recalled characteristic pain in the past 2 days; and daily diary ratings of pain intensity from which "actual" least, worst, and average pain scores were derived. Recall ratings of least and average pain, and a composite score representing recalled characteristic pain were accurate (differed no more than three points from "actual" scores on a 0-100 scale). Although the recall rating of worst pain significantly (P < 0.05) overestimated actual worst pain, the differences were minor (i.e., seven to eight points on a 0-100 scale). All of the recall measures demonstrated validity via their strong associations with the measures of actual pain intensity. The recall measures also demonstrated excellent test-retest stability, although the diary-derived measures tended to be more stable than the recall measures did. The composite measure of recalled characteristic pain demonstrated a high level of internal consistency (Cronbach's α = 0.90). Individual recall ratings and a composite score representing recalled characteristic pain intensity are reliable and valid measures of actual pain in patients with cancer. The findings support their use as outcome measures in clinical trials.
